The system is an in-building IF distribution system designed to accommodate subscribers in shaded or blanket areas of a building. With the goal of improving the wireless environment, the system can be used to receive signals from independent repeaters or BTS, transform them, and then transmit them to anywhere in the building through coaxial cable. The long distance transmission capacity of the system allows it to be suitable for installation in large buildings. |
 |
 |
 |
The function and application of the equipment are same as those in in-building HFC. HFC connects RAU and REAU through RF signals. The high-powered in-building IF distribution system is stable in output because it minimizes transmission cable loss by lowering bandwidth by transforming RF signals to IF signals. |
